|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
Здравствуйте! подскажите , пожалуйста, как в конструкции DoCmd.OutputTo Код: vbnet 1. 2. 3. 4.
прописать имя создаваемого листа в Excel-e? Сейчас имя листа создается как "SELECT COPDBC as Кодировка, cc " Спасибо заранее за помощь! ... |
|||
:
Нравится:
Не нравится:
|
|||
26.07.2019, 17:22 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
-SWAN-, Читайте HELP-второй аргумент "строковое выражение представляющее допустимое имя объекта тип которого указан в аргументе типОбъекта" (первый аргумент) А может у Вас,батенька, таблица с таким именем, SQLQery, имеется,которое ни разу не стринг ИмяФайла(4 аргумент)-строка:полное имя файла в который выводится объект Да и формат у Вас очень интересный Надоело HELP повторять-Вы лучше его прочтите 6400575 ... |
|||
:
Нравится:
Не нравится:
|
|||
26.07.2019, 18:35 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
sdku, О, идол мой любимый, стоящий на первом месте, ты не направляй в хелп и не посылай в туда, Просто как обычно покажи как - Надо. ... |
|||
:
Нравится:
Не нравится:
|
|||
26.07.2019, 18:53 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
sdku-SWAN-, Читайте HELP-второй аргумент "строковое выражение представляющее допустимое имя объекта тип которого указан в аргументе типОбъекта" (первый аргумент) А может у Вас,батенька, таблица с таким именем, SQLQery, имеется,которое ни разу не стринг ИмяФайла(4 аргумент)-строка:полное имя файла в который выводится объект Да и формат у Вас очень интересный Надоело HELP повторять-Вы лучше его прочтите 6400575 Мой код рабочий! Единственный минус - создается лист с названием "SELECT COPDBC as Кодировка, cc " Как во второй аргумент прописать название листа, или это в принципе невозможно?? 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 11:24 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
-SWAN-Как во второй аргумент прописать название листа, или это в принципе невозможно??Из HELP: Синтаксис DoCmd.OutputTo типОбъекта[,имяОбъекта](для тех кто в танке- импортируемого объекта) [,формат] [, ИМЯ-ФАЙЛА] (в который выводится объект)[, àавтозагрузка][, файлШаблона] Название файла в 4 аргументе,а не во втором!! Вам же рекомендовано читать HELP,где все написано 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 12:52 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
-SWAN-Как во второй аргумент прописать название листа, или это в принципе невозможно??Из HELP: Синтаксис DoCmd.OutputTo типОбъекта[,имяОбъекта](для тех кто в танке- импортируемого объекта) [,формат] [, ИМЯ-ФАЙЛА] (в который выводится объект)[, автозагрузка][, файлШаблона] Название файла в 4 аргументе,а не во втором!! Вам же рекомендовано читать HELP,где все написано 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 12:53 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
Вы хоть читаете что Вам пишут В HELP нет ни слова про инструкцию SELECT которую Вы пытаетесь подсунуть методу в качестве имени объекта sdku...А может у Вас,батенька, таблица с таким именем, SQLQery, имеется... 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 13:00 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
-SWAN- Код: vbnet 1. 2.
Я и не знал, что так можно (тип объекта - таблица и SQL выражение). Если имя листа одно и то же при каждом экспорте, то создайте запрос с этим именем и его выгружайте. Другой вариант - после создания файла получить к нему доступ (например GetObject) и переименовать лист. А почему именно DoCmd.OutputTo? Используйте запрос на создание таблицы. Код: vbnet 1.
Этот запрос создаст лист с указанным именем. 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 13:05 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
Кривцов Анатолий, 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 13:27 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
И на старуху бывает проруха не импортируемого,а выводимого объекта 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 13:28 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
Кривцов Анатолий-SWAN- Код: vbnet 1. 2.
Я и не знал, что так можно (тип объекта - таблица и SQL выражение). Если имя листа одно и то же при каждом экспорте, то создайте запрос с этим именем и его выгружайте. Другой вариант - после создания файла получить к нему доступ (например GetObject) и переименовать лист. А почему именно DoCmd.OutputTo? Используйте запрос на создание таблицы. Код: vbnet 1.
Этот запрос создаст лист с указанным именем. запрос Код: vbnet 1. 2.
выдает ошибку: 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 15:56 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
сама ошибка может что-то неправильно записал в запросе? 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 15:57 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 16:39 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 16:41 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
-SWAN-courtпропущено... У тебя adp ? да, adpЗначит запросом не получится. Этот запрос для Акцессовского Jet-SQL 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 16:45 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
-SWAN-, кстате, а почему ты делаешь не через TransferSpreadsheet В нём твоя "хотелка" есть :) https://access-excel.tips/access-vba-cocmd-transferspreadsheet/ If you specify a Range name in the argument but it doesn’t exit in Excel, the argument name would become the Worksheet name. Код: vbnet 1. 2. 3.
...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 16:49 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
court-SWAN-, кстате, а почему ты делаешь не через TransferSpreadsheet В нём твоя "хотелка" есть :) https://access-excel.tips/access-vba-cocmd-transferspreadsheet/ If you specify a Range name in the argument but it doesn’t exit in Excel, the argument name would become the Worksheet name. Код: vbnet 1. 2. 3.
у меня запрос формируется на-лету, поэтому не получается через TableName:="Query1" 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 16:57 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
или я не догоняю? через DoCmd.TransferSpreadsheet можно ведь только сохраненные запросы или таблицы? 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 16:59 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
-SWAN-у меня запрос формируется на-лету, поэтому не получается через TableName:="Query1" Нуу и создай, по этому "сформированному на лету" запросу вьюху (с нужным именем, тогда и с Range можно не заморачиваться) Экспортируешь её, а потом можно её и drop-нуть ... |
|||
:
Нравится:
Не нравится:
|
|||
29.07.2019, 17:05 |
|
DoCmd.OutputTo - как задать имя создаваемого Листа Excel?
|
|||
---|---|---|---|
#18+
sdku-SWAN-Как во второй аргумент прописать название листа, или это в принципе невозможно??Из HELP: Синтаксис DoCmd.OutputTo типОбъекта[,имяОбъекта](для тех кто в танке- импортируемого объекта) [,формат] [, ИМЯ-ФАЙЛА] (в который выводится объект)[, автозагрузка][, файлШаблона] Название файла в 4 аргументе,а не во втором!! Вам же рекомендовано читать HELP,где все написано Зачем же так нервничать? Я всегда сначала читаю HELP! а уж потом задаю вопросы. И ещё раз повторю - мой код рабочий (для .adp) Спасибо ВСЕМ за помощь! ... |
|||
:
Нравится:
Не нравится:
|
|||
30.07.2019, 13:19 |
|
|
start [/forum/topic.php?fid=45&msg=39842023&tid=1610560]: |
0ms |
get settings: |
9ms |
get forum list: |
13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
42ms |
get topic data: |
12ms |
get forum data: |
3ms |
get page messages: |
61ms |
get tp. blocked users: |
2ms |
others: | 14ms |
total: | 164ms |
0 / 0 |